Dr. Shreya Gupta on Imposter Syndrome and Growth in Medicine

In this episode of More Than Mountains, I sit down with Dr. Shreya Gupta to explore her journey through medicine—from undergrad to medical school and into residency. She reflects on the experiences that shaped her path, the challenges that mattered most, and the moments of self-doubt and imposter syndrome along the way.

We discuss the realities of medical training that often aren’t shown publicly, including evolving study strategies, emotional challenges, mental health, and the balance between empathy and self-preservation in patient care. Dr. Gupta also shares insights on what continues to inspire her in medicine despite the demands of residency.

This conversation highlights the mission of More Than Mountains which is uncovering the human side of medicine, amplifying honest conversations about growth and struggle, and reminding listeners that every journey is more than what it appears on the surface.
